We had another busy week at TalkAndroid so here’s a recap of all the top stories. The Moto G was officially announced, and could very well be a very popular phone based on it’s amazing price. KitKat was officially released for the Nexus 7 and Nexus 10, and Google updated Google Search, bringing the Google Experience Launcher unofficially to Android 4.1+ devices. We are still slowing getting info about the HTC One followup, but the One Max is now available in the U.S. Samsung continues to improve the unpopular Galaxy Gear, but they continue to struggle with Apple in the courtroom.
